Output 521e53ceb1dabd7d24a59ecedfe2a452fed07e4baa02ac4f93ab59110caad781:10

value
9881718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f64349b00e38e53550dcbf83a89c83955dc30b62 OP_EQUAL
address
3Q98kyXBesRqkEAVzenh6NCyJXDwGfrGZj
transaction
521e53ceb1dabd7d24a59ecedfe2a452fed07e4baa02ac4f93ab59110caad781
confirmations
313031
spent
true